HURFORD ROAD NEWS
PERSONAL AND GENERAL. A large crowd was present at the third euchre party in the Hurford Road hall, 17| tables being occupied. The winners were Miss Maisie Berridge and Mrs. N. Jury, who tied for first place, and Master E. Green (Koru). . A meeting of members of the Waireka Yards Association was held on Monday night to consider the. winding up and liquidation of the association. It was decided to call tenders for the purchase of the yards, shed and scales. A long night dance organised by the basketball club was held in the hair on Wednesday, when there was a large attendance. The net proceeds amounted to about £3. • Music for the dance was supplied by Mr. F. Williams’ orchestra and Mr. T. Allsopp played an extra. Mr. T. Ryan was master of ceremonies. Monte Carlo waltzes were won by Miss W. Marsh and Mr. A. Thomas and Mr. and Mrs. P. Johnson. Confetti and streamer dances added to the enjoyment of the evening. A euchre party was held for nondancers, eight tables being engaged, the winners being Mrs. J. Lynch and Mr. A. Hoffman. The organising committee was Misses D. Vickers, N. Berridge, M. Berridge, D. Higgins, I. and W. Marsh, M. and T. Schrider and L. Maloney.
